Stirred, boozy, and beloved by bartenders across the globe, the Hanky Panky feels like a modern creation but it's steeped in history, having been created over 100 years ago by Ada "Coley" Coleman at the American Bar at the Savoy hotel. Here to join us today and share his expertise on the drink is Ektoras Binikos, a New-York-based long-time industry pro, and co-owner of Sugar Monk in Harlem and the upcoming Bitter Monk at Brooklyn's Industry City. Listen on (or read below) to discover Ektoras' Hanky Pankny recipe — and don’t forget to like, review and subscribe!  Ektoras Binikos' Hanky Panky Recipe (Classic) Ingredients - 1 ½ ounces London Dry Gin - 1 ½ ounces sweet vermouth - 2 or 3 dashes (or small teaspoon/barspoon) Fernet Branca  Directions 1. Combine all ingredients in a mixing glass with ice. 2. Stir until cold and strain into a chilled Coupe or Nick & Nora glass. 3. Garnish with an orange twist.  Ektoras Binikos' Hanky Panky Recipe (Sugar Monk riff) Ingredients - 1 ½ ounces unaged genever - 1 ½ ounces sweet vermouth - 2 or 3 dashes (or small teaspoon/barspoon) Fernet Branca - 2 or 3 drops housemade orange bitters  Directions 1. Combine all ingredients in a mixing glass with ice. 2. Stir until cold and strain into a chilled Coupe or Nick & Nora glass.3. Garnish with an orange twist.   Hosted on Acast.
